You can buy window locks made of ash

Sash window locks are a common method of keeping your windows secure. They keep intruders out of opening the windows completely. They can be used with any kind of window. If it's a sliding sliding sash or fixed window, they're easy to install.

There are two types window locks that sash one screw catch or the Fitch fastener. Both are used to secure windows however, the Fitch lock is the most secure. Its lever is half-circle-shaped, making it harder to open from the outside.

If you have a small sash window, one Fitch fastener may be sufficient. For larger windows, you'll have to buy two Fitch fasteners.

The Fitch fastener, which is an easy device, seals the frame and sash, preventing windows from being forced upwards. A bolt with a half-thread is inserted into each side of the upper sash. A second barrel with a threaded head is screwed into the opposite side of the lower.

There are other types of sash windows locks such as the Quadrant and Brighton fasteners. Each has its unique design, but all share the same purpose. If you're looking to repair or replace your sash windows, you'll have to purchase the appropriate lock to complete the task.

A drill and a screwdriver are also required. First, take off any paint or debris from the window sash to be removed.

Once you've secured the lock then drill pilot holes into the frame. Then , you'll need the fastener into the holes.

Sash window mouldings are found in hardwood or softwood

Sash windows have an sash that is able to be moved. This helps to maintain an airtight seal and avoid drafts and air leaks from the window.

Sashes are traditionally made from softwood or hardwood. However, a variety new materials can be utilized. Vinyl sashes are often multi-chambered to avoid distortion. They are generally less expensive than their conventional counterparts.

Sash windows are an essential component of window design. They should be maintained in a timely manner to ensure they remain in good working order. Inability to maintain them can cause leaky windows that let in water. A few simple maintenance steps can ensure they're functioning for a long time.

The first step is to ensure that the sash is free of paint and putty. Putty and paint can make water get into the window. The sash should also be free of glazing compound. If the glass is damaged by cracks, remove it and replace it.

Then, look over the cords. A damaged sash can be difficult to open and move. It is vital that the sash cord is sufficiently long to allow it to open fully. It should be secured so that it doesn't slip through the frame.

If the wood has been exposed to weather, it is necessary to replace the window sash. Damaged or worn  window glass replacement bexley  can also cause rattles or draughts.

Chains or anti-lift systems can be used to increase the security of your window sash. You should match the current window when you install new ironmongery.
